SPECIFICATIONS

Parameters
Height Seated (Max) 1.75mm
Length 4.9mm
RoHS Status ROHS3 Compliant
Lead Free Lead Free
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154, 3.90mm Width)
Number of Pins 8
Operating Temperature 0°C~70°C
Packaging Tape & Reel (TR)
Published 1999
JESD-609 Code e3
Part Status Obsolete
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 8
Terminal Finish Matte Tin (Sn)
Subcategory Delay Lines
Technology CMOS
Voltage - Supply 2.7V~3.6V
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) 260
Supply Voltage 3.3V
Terminal Pitch 1.27mm
Time@Peak Reflow Temperature-Max (s) NOT SPECIFIED
Base Part Number DS1033
Function Multiple, NonProgrammable
Qualification Status Not Qualified
Supply Voltage-Min (Vsup) 2.7V
Family CMOS/TTL
Output Polarity TRUE
Logic IC Type SILICON DELAY LINE
Power Supply Current-Max (ICC) 25mA
Number of Taps/Steps 1
Number of Independent Delays 3
Delay to 1st Tap 8ns
Programmable Delay Line NO
Total Delay-Nom (td) 8 ns
Input Frequency-Max (fmax) 62.5MHz
